jiangping
2023-12-29 f9691d544e62d6c04dbfe45d05a6c7bc5e004291
server/services/src/main/java/com/doumee/dao/business/model/Refund.java
@@ -1,15 +1,14 @@
package com.doumee.dao.business.model;
import com.baomidou.mybatisplus.annotation.*;
import com.doumee.core.annotation.excel.ExcelColumn;
import io.swagger.annotations.ApiModel;
import io.swagger.annotations.ApiModelProperty;
import com.baomidou.mybatisplus.annotation.IdType;
import com.baomidou.mybatisplus.annotation.TableId;
import com.baomidou.mybatisplus.annotation.TableName;
import lombok.Data;
import com.fasterxml.jackson.annotation.JsonFormat;
import java.util.Date;
import java.math.BigDecimal;
import java.util.List;
/**
 * 退款信息表
@@ -45,6 +44,7 @@
    @ApiModelProperty(value = "是否已删除 0未删除 1已删除", example = "1")
    @ExcelColumn(name="是否已删除 0未删除 1已删除")
    @TableLogic
    private Integer isdeleted;
    @ApiModelProperty(value = "备注")
@@ -57,7 +57,11 @@
    @ApiModelProperty(value = "用户编码(关联member表)", example = "1")
    @ExcelColumn(name="用户编码(关联member表)")
    private BigDecimal memberId;
    private String memberId;
    @ApiModelProperty(value = "可退金额", example = "1")
    @ExcelColumn(name="可退回押金(元)" )
    private BigDecimal canBalance;
    @ApiModelProperty(value = "交易金额", example = "1")
    @ExcelColumn(name="交易金额")
@@ -84,9 +88,12 @@
    //@JsonFormat(pattern = "yyyy-MM-dd")
    private Date doneDate;
    @ApiModelProperty(value = "退款类型 0结算退款 1强制结算退款 2结算后退款", example = "1")
    @ExcelColumn(name="退款类型 0结算退款 1强制结算退款 2结算后退款")
    @ApiModelProperty(value = "退款类型 0用户结算退款 1平台自动结算退款 2强制结算退款 3结算后退款'", example = "1")
    @ExcelColumn(name="退款类型 0用户结算退款 1平台自动结算退款 2强制结算退款 3结算后退款'")
    private Integer type;
    @ApiModelProperty(value = "退款类型 0结算退款 1强制结算退款 2结算后退款", example = "1")
    @TableField(exist = false)
    private List<Integer> typeList;
    @ApiModelProperty(value = "退款关联订单编码")
    @ExcelColumn(name="退款关联订单编码")
@@ -95,5 +102,29 @@
    @ApiModelProperty(value = "退款原因")
    @ExcelColumn(name="退款原因")
    private String reason;
    @ApiModelProperty(value = "操作人")
    @TableField(exist = false)
    private String creatorName;
    @ApiModelProperty(value = "用户")
    @TableField(exist = false)
    private String openid;
    @ApiModelProperty(value = "支付押金交易单号")
    @TableField(exist = false)
    private String payOnlineOrderid;
    @ApiModelProperty(value = "交易笔数", example = "0")
    @TableField(exist = false)
    private int countNum;
    @ApiModelProperty(value = "查询开始日期(包含)", example = "2023-10-01 15:12:01")
    @TableField(exist = false)
    @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
    private Date startDate;
    @ApiModelProperty(value = "查询截止日期(包含)", example = "2023-10-09 15:12:05")
    @TableField(exist = false)
    @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
    private Date endDate;
}